AWS Device Farm provides many different mobile devices for you to test your site with, while providing you with a service similar to remote desktop which lets you interact with the device as if you were using it, allowing you to see exactly how your site or app works. I have used the device farm many times to track down problems with sites that only certain users were experiencing. You can be testing several IOS devices, and several different Android devices with a few clicks of the mouse. The pricing structure is done on demand, which lets my costs be very low, especially compared to the alternative of buying devices outright, or renting physical units. The amount of devices is limited, which results in a wait time until you can use them, though I have never experienced over a 10 minute wait, which is much less than the time involved in renting or borrowing physical devices. I would like to see touch-screen integration happen at some point, as using mouse to control devices designed for touch can be a pain, especially when you are using a touch enabled laptop to test on, though that feature would simply be for convenience.
